Description
Our client, a healthcare system located near Charlotte, NC, has a need for a Director of Radiology to join their team. The Director will oversee 2 hospitals (totaling around 200 beds but expanding soon) and a FSED.
They are looking for someone that has already been a Director or a Manager for a decent amount of time. They want more established infrastructure experience with Epic, Radiant, financials, budget development, process improvements, consistent high patient and teammate satisfaction scores, as well as a higher level integration into the facility with other service lines.
Essential Functions
- Develops a long range operational plan relative to services, programs, capital and human resource planning.
- Develops an annual capital equipment and replacement plan. Recommends equipment modification, new equipment, and necessary renovations and construction projects. Develops the annual operational and capital equipment budget.
- Collects, generates, analyzes, and distributes various reports, documents, and statistical data as required.
- Follows up on error correction and establishes corrective action to address identified problems with patients, physicians, and employees.
- Approves various departmental purchases, product evaluations, space and equipment utilization as determined by hospital policy.
- Evaluates all divisions' quality of services and patient/employee safety using various monitors to rate performance. Makes various recommendations for quality improvements,
- Maintains proper liaison between hospital administration, medical staff, employees, and contractual groups.
- Contributes to the need to alter existing services or create new services based upon observed or marketing trends and surveys.
QUALIFICATIONS
- High School Diploma or GED required.
- Bachelor's Degree in Business or Health Care Administration required, or equivalent experience required.
- Minimum of 5 years leadership experience required.
- ARRT preferred. AHRA membership preferred.
